Further components of this widely scattered collection, also generally from west to east, are Tuvalu, Wallis and Futuna, Tokelau, Samoa (former West Samoa), American Samoa, Tonga, Niue, the Cook Islands and French Polynesia (including the Society, Tuamotu and Marquesas Islands). The Tetiaroa is one of the Society Islands in French Polynesia. The name of the island is a Polynesian word for "stands apart" or "at a distance".
